Palamu, July 09 (ANI): Police arrested three Maoists with arms and ammunition in Palamu district of Jharkhand. Acting on a tip-off, a special police team conducted search operation and arrested three members of new ultra outfit _Sashastra People_s Morcha_ (SPM) while two others escaped. Superintendent of Police, Y S Ramesh, said they were involved in setting ablaze three machines of a private firm, which were engaged in implementing social forestry project. Maoists, also known as Naxals, have killed police and politicians, and targeted government buildings and railway tracks in an insurgency that has killed thousands since 1960s.
